Ensuring Data Security and Privacy
In today’s digital world, data security and privacy are paramount concerns. Users are increasingly aware of the risks associated with sharing their personal information online, and they demand platforms that prioritize their security. A robust security infrastructure is essential, incorporating measures such as encryption, firewalls, and intrusion detection systems. Regularly updated security protocols are crucial to stay ahead of evolving cyber threats. Platforms should also comply with relevant data privacy regulations, such as GDPR (General Data Protection Regulation) or CCPA (California Consumer Privacy Act). Transparency about data collection and usage practices is vital for building trust with users.
Beyond technical security measures, it is important to consider the platform’s data handling practices. Where is user data stored? How is it protected from unauthorized access? What is the platform’s data retention policy? These questions should be addressed proactively, and users should have the ability to control their data and exercise their privacy rights. Two-factor authentication (2FA) is a powerful security measure that adds an extra layer of protection to user accounts. Encouraging users to enable 2FA can significantly reduce the risk of unauthorized access. Furthermore, regular security audits can identify vulnerabilities and ensure that security protocols are functioning effectively.
- Implement strong password policies.
- Enable two-factor authentication (2FA).
- Be wary of phishing attempts.
- Keep software and devices updated.
- Regularly review privacy settings.
Taking these proactive steps can significantly enhance your online security. It's a shared responsibility between the platform provider and the user to maintain a secure digital environment. Remaining vigilant and informed about potential threats is essential.

Common Issues and Their Resolutions
Many issues can be resolved with simple troubleshooting steps. First, clear your browser’s cache and cookies. This can often resolve issues related to outdated or corrupted data. Second, try using a different browser or device to see if the problem persists. This can help determine if the issue is specific to your browser or device. Third, check your internet connection to ensure it’s stable. A weak or unreliable connection can cause various problems. Finally, consult the platform’s help center or FAQ section for specific guidance on troubleshooting common issues. These resources often provide step-by-step instructions and solutions to frequently encountered problems.
If the problem persists after trying these steps, it’s time to contact customer support. Be prepared to provide detailed information about the issue, including any error messages, screenshots, and steps you’ve already taken to resolve it. A clear and concise description of the problem will help the support team understand the issue and provide more effective assistance. Keep a record of all communication with support, including the date, time, and the name of the support representative. This documentation can be helpful if you need to follow up on the issue later.
- Clear your browser cache and cookies.
- Try a different browser or device.
- Check your internet connection.
- Consult the platform's help center.
- Contact customer support.
Following these steps will equip you with the resources to address and resolve most typical issues encountered while using online platforms.
